Solve 2(×+5) +3×=20 equation with variable on one side

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ation: distributive property.

2x+10+3x=20

Then you add the like terms:

2x+3x=5x

Whatever is left you put is an equation all together then solve:

5x+10=20

-10=-10

5x=10

Divide 10 by five

Answer is: x=2
